Transaction 75eb6480716495d1f9454b13e0b207772b553f9454139336f10d6a7789b43daf
1 Input
2 Outputs
- 75eb6480716495d1f9454b13e0b207772b553f9454139336f10d6a7789b43daf:0
- 75eb6480716495d1f9454b13e0b207772b553f9454139336f10d6a7789b43daf:1
value 2499794140
address myWUFwpkFXCQXUbZzK4JTN8uBhPwLzG6U3
value 62500
address mjxunT5SCKLFcscBW826qCVXr5WJYySJiA